A coven of vampires operates out of a modeling/escort agency known as Blonde Heaven. Angie came from Oklahoma to find her way into the movie business, but is followed by her boyfriend Kyle. Head vamp Illyana takes a liking to Angie and convinces her to do escort work for the agency, but has other recruiting plans for her as well. While the vampires do their sleazy work around LA (and Angie gets in over her head), Kyle and a vampire hunter team up to try and stop the fiends.

- Release Date 10/28/1995
- Language English
- Director David DeCoteau
- Writers Matthew Jason Walsh, Mark Millenko, Kenneth J. Hall
- Editor Paul Petschek
- Cinematographer James Lawrence Spencer
- Producers Karen L. Spencer, Michael Deak
- Companies TorchLight Entertainment, Full Moon Entertainment
- Budget $200,000
